Running too rich maf
Ok my car started to stall, i got a check engine light on P1127 is the code bad MAF, vacuum leak. now where do i look for vacuum leaks and how to spot them. and i dont understand what running too rich exactly means. sorry not very good when it comes to cars.. :P and also i have a rough start my rps are all over the place when i first start the car i even have to give it gas because i seems like its gonna shut off.... any ideas THANKS GUYS
Running rich means that the Fuel/Air ratio is higher than is needed. TTs run a little rich anyway (note black soot on tailpipe) but too rich will foul plugs, waste gas, and generally make the car run poorly.
First off, try unplugging the MAF and see if it runs better. If it does then the MAF is dirty or needs to be replaced.
Vacuum leaks are a bit trickier to locate, your best bet is to do a pressure test and a little soap/water to look for bubbles. You can buy a test fitting and gauge from Modshack.info or you can make one yourself with some PVC fittings and a gauge.
Inspect all of your vacuum lines. One that often fails is an S-shaped one that connects on the underside of the intake manifold to the PVC valve.
